Novartis stock holds above $150 after orphan drug update
Published on 08/19/2026 at 17:19 | Editorial responsibility: Rafael Müller, Editor-in-Chief AD HOC NEWS
Novartis AG stock (CH0012005267) closed at $151.97 on August 17, 2026, and the latest US quote in the session showed $150.98 at 12:02 p.m. EDT on August 19, 2026. The move sits against a market value of $287.90 billion and a recent regulatory update that gave investors a fresh reason to stay engaged.
Recent coverage says Novartis announced orphan-drug designation for iptacopan in atypical hemolytic uremic syndrome on August 18, 2026. That same coverage places the shares at $154.55 on August 18, 2026, which is 18.5 percent above a $130.41 fair-value benchmark in the article.
Pipeline catalyst
For Novartis, the key point is not just the designation itself but what it signals about the rare-disease franchise around iptacopan. The drug is still investigational, yet the update extends a pipeline that is already tied to specialty medicine revenue potential if later-stage work and approvals progress.
The valuation picture adds another layer. The article cites an average analyst target of $141.20, a low target of $112.00 and a high target of $180.00, putting the latest US quote above the average but below the top of the range.

Leqvio and Entresto
One representative Novartis product is Leqvio, an inclisiran therapy that the company will feature in cardiovascular data at ESC Congress 2026. Another visible part of the portfolio is Entresto, which remains one of the group's most recognizable medicines and continues to anchor the cardiovascular franchise.
Those names matter because Novartis is using established brands and newer pipeline assets together rather than leaning on a single catalyst. The August 19, 2026 congress program underscores that mix with 10 abstracts across the cardiovascular portfolio.
